In himself he is always the same (1 Samuel 15:29); but the aspect which his character and dealings assume toward them is determined by their own character and conduct, and is the necessary manifestation of his unchangeable rectitude - on the one hand, toward the "loving," etc., full of love (all that is kind, desirable, and excellent); on the other, toward the "perverse," perverse (contrary, antagonistic, "as an enemy," Lamentations 2:5; Leviticus 26:23, 24; Hosea 2:6), inflicting severe chastisement. He was conscientious about taking care of his dads sheep. David affirms, All His ordinances were before me, and I did not put away His statutes from me (18:22). We need to understand that David isnt comparing himself with God, in whose sight no one is righteous, but with his enemies, who do not follow God.
